Just picked up this 12 f250 with trans issues I know that these have issues with shift solenoids going out but I don't know how to tell it trys to skip gears but when I get up to speed it just loses everything until I pull over and shut it off and turn it back on. I also smelled the trans fluid and it smells burnt which leads me to believe the trans is smoked. I don't know if that could be from the guy not changing fluid or something.
Sounds as if your clutches and steels are burnt. When the fluid temp is cool they will grab but when the fluid gets to temp and less viscous they will fail. A trans rebuild is definitely in your future.

If you have a reputable transmission shop near by bring them your valve body and have them do a vacuum test on it. It will give you an idea if the valve body is properly sealing or if you have bore wear.
